Dismount your original tires from the wheels and swap the original TPMS sensors from the aluminum wheels into the steel wheels. Then mount the snows on the steel wheels. This way the TPMS unit will be looking for the sensors it already knows, so the dealer trip will not be required.Use the INFO button to scroll through to the PAX RESET screen, then press the SEL/RESET button on the steering wheel. 4. The TPMS light means there is something wrong in the system. If you replaced all the sensors, then it is not likely any of the sensors. But it could be the TPMS control unit. To be sure, you will need to use a scanner tool that is capable of reading the TPMS trouble codes. Generic OBD2 scanners cannot do this.
